Level A English in upper secondary school, or equivalent skills (B1-B2 level of language competence). To achieve the required starting level, students may for example take an English prep course.
After completing this study module, students will - be able to express themselves clearly and in a manner appropriate to the situation - be able to discuss and negotiate different issues while taking other participants into account - be able to hold a prepared presentation on a topic related to their own field of study These skills will help students in their studies and later in following their own field and improving professional international communication.
Contents
During this course, students will - tell about themselves and their studies - discuss issues related to their own field of study - use expressions required by different situations (e.g. negotiations, debates, interviews) - become familiar with the general characteristics of a good presentation as well as with cultural practices of spoken English - hold an oral presentation
